温馨提示×

ubuntu telnet如何进行身份验证

小樊
39
2025-11-02 06:05:05
栏目: 智能运维

在Ubuntu系统中,使用Telnet进行身份验证通常涉及以下步骤:

  1. 安装Telnet客户端: 如果你的Ubuntu系统上还没有安装Telnet客户端,你可以使用以下命令来安装它:

    sudo apt update
    sudo apt install telnetd
    
  2. 启动Telnet服务: 安装完成后,你需要启动Telnet服务。这通常是通过启动inetdxinetd服务来完成的,这些服务会监听网络请求并将它们转发给相应的应用程序(如Telnet)。

    sudo systemctl start inetd
    

    或者,如果你使用的是xinetd

    sudo systemctl start xinetd
    
  3. 配置Telnet服务: 你可能需要编辑/etc/xinetd.d/telnet文件来配置Telnet服务,确保它允许连接并设置了正确的身份验证方法。

  4. 设置防火墙规则: 确保你的防火墙允许Telnet连接。你可以使用ufw来配置防火墙规则:

    sudo ufw allow telnet
    
  5. 连接到Telnet服务器: 使用Telnet客户端连接到服务器。例如:

    telnet your_server_ip_address
    
  6. 身份验证: 连接建立后,服务器会提示你输入用户名和密码。输入正确的凭据以完成身份验证。

  7. 使用Telnet会话: 一旦通过身份验证,你就可以开始使用Telnet会话了。

请注意,Telnet传输的数据(包括用户名和密码)是不加密的,这意味着它们可能会被截获。因此,Telnet不推荐用于需要安全性的环境。对于更安全的远程登录,建议使用SSH(Secure Shell)协议。

如果你需要对Telnet服务进行更高级的身份验证,比如使用PAM(Pluggable Authentication Modules),你可能需要编辑/etc/pam.d/telnetd文件来配置相应的PAM模块。

在配置和使用Telnet服务时,请确保你了解相关的安全风险,并采取适当的安全措施。

0